Johnson bid rejected

January 7 2006

Andy Johnson

Andy Johnson

Simon Jordan has rejected a bid by Birmingham City for Andrew Johnson.

Johnson's former club Birmingham City offered £3 million plus two unnamed players for the England striker.

The forward signed a new five year contract in August and commited his future to Palace.

Birmingham owner David Sullivan said: "We have been told that Andrew Johnson is not for sale.

"Their view is they're going for promotion and wouldn't look at selling him until the summer at least, assuming they didn't make it."

Jordan has already rejected a £5.5m bid for Johnson from West Ham in December.
